摘要
本文从拉梅公式,莫尔强度理论出发,通过引入拉压强度极限比V、等强度系数β,导出了单镶套模具的设计公式;揭示了容许内压p随K、β、V、[σ]的变化规律;提出了予紧过盈量的最佳选择范围。通过算例说明合理选择配对材料和适当加火过盈量是提高模具寿命的有效途径。
In this paper, according to leme equations and mohr's theory, the new design formulas of single shrinking-on cold forming die arc deduced from introducing tension-compression specific intensity factor V and equal intensity factor β. it is important to show the allowance inner pressurc p as functions ofK. V. β.[σ] and put forward the best range of shrinking-on allowance. Reasonable selecting die material and increasing shrinking allowance arc interpreted as the effective measures for lasting die life.
